Caught your last two podcasts with Carson - great stuff as always. Are there any strong correlations between spin rate and other pitch metrics? ie. higher RPM = lower contact rate, higher chase rate, lower xwOBA, etc.
Travis Sawchik
12:28
Higher rpm on four seamers has a strong relationship with greater swing and miss, lower spin should generate more ground balls

Are pitchers able to have any influence over launch angle against? Or does launch angle data help pitchers understand how/where to pitch to certain hitters?
Travis Sawchik
12:39
Launch angle is higher against elevated pitches, so yes
